צַיִד
tsayid · tsah'-yidHebrew · H6718
Derivation
from a form of H6679 (צוּד) and meaning the same;
Meaning
the chase; also game (thus taken); (generally) lunch (especially for a journey)
In the King James Version
[idiom] catcheth, food, [idiom] hunter, (that which he took in) hunting, venison, victuals.
Translated as
venison (8), hunter (3), provision (2), catcheth (1), victuals (1), food (1), hunting (1)
Where it appears
Found in 16 verses
